> I wanted to try (using ConTeXt minimals MkIV) the example on page 228
> of the MetaFun manual, dealing with typesetting in MetaPost.
>
> The code is given as:
>
> \resetMPdrawing
> \startMPdrawing
> picture pic[] ;
> numeric wid[], len[], pos[], n ;
> wid[0] := len[0] := pos[0] := n := 0 ;
> \stopMPdrawing
>
> \def\whatever#1%
> {\appendtoks#1\to\MPtoks
> \setbox\MPbox=\hbox{\bfd\the\MPtoks}%
> \startMPdrawing
> n := n + 1 ; len[n] := \the\wd\MPbox ;
> \stopMPdrawing
> \startMPdrawing[-]
> pic[n] := textext("\bfd\setstrut\strut#1") ;
> pic[n] := pic[n] shifted - llcorner pic[n] ;
> \stopMPdrawing}
>
> \handletokens MetaPost is Fun!\with\whatever
>
> But is won't run. The following message is generated:

Hi,
I'm in need of help to get the example as described in the MetaFun
manual running, because I want to use text around a path!
So, I started reading the chapter about 'Typesetting in METAPOST' and
wanted to try the examples as given in that chapter, but without succes!
The problem seem to be the MPtoks macro. According to the text in this
chapter this low level macro (and MPbox and appendtoks) are already
defined, but are they really?
The version of context minimals I use at the moment is:
MTXrun | current version: 2011.01.18 19:34
Any suggestions are very much welcomed! Thanks in advance!
